Hefekranz

ingredients
1 tablespoon yeast
1 teaspoon sugar
1/4 cup water
1 pound bread flour
4 ounces sugar
2 ounces butter, melted
3 eggs
1/4 cup warm milk
1 cup raisins
directions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Dissolve yeast in water and sugar. Stir well and allow to rise in a warm place.
In a mixing bowl, combine flour, yeast mix, sugar, butter, eggs and raisins.
Mix dough, adding milk gradually until dough is elastic and does not stick to sides of bowl. Shape dough into a ball. Cover with plastic wrap and let rise at room temperature until triple in volume.
Punch down the dough. Shape into a ball. Cover and refrigerate overnight.
Divide dough into three parts. Roll each piece into 16 inch long logs. Braid the three sections of dough. Place in center of a baking sheet. Let rise at room temperature for two hours.
Brush dough with warm milk. Bake for about 30 minutes.
